Hiking Trail Conditions Report
Peaks
Peaks North Hancock, South Hancock, NH
Trails
Trails: Hancock Notch Trail, Cedar Brook Trail, Hancock Loop Trail
Date of Hike
Date of Hike: Saturday, April 22, 2023

Surface Conditions
Surface Conditions: Wet Trail, Standing/Running Water on Trail, Snow/Ice - Monorail (Stable), Snow - Spring Snow, Snow/Ice - Postholes 
Recommended Equipment
Recommended Equipment: Snowshoes, Light Traction 
Water Crossing Notes
Water Crossing Notes: Levels were moderately high today and a couple crossings required an inch or two of water over my boots but I have short legs that were made for riding in airplanes, not rock leaping. MVPs of the day were my waterproof socks!

Comments
Comments: Posting mostly for the lost and found since conditions will change with tomorrow's storm, but I donned spikes around 2/3 of a mile in. A number of open wet patches at lower lying areas around Cedar Brook and even some heading up the Loop trail. Monorail was firm enough on this 40ish degree day to support my petite frame so the snowshoes stayed on my pack today. Monorail is narrowing in spots and sometimes elevated but nothing like the Death Rail of previous winters that were much snowier. Mixed conditions heading up North including a couple icy sections but there are enough trees to make them pretty straightforward. Much more consistent snow cover heading down South and a good amount of nice steps in the snow so it's clockwise for the win.
